## Gross-Margin Review — Restricted: Managers Only

This page summarises the FY review of gross margin across the Tolliver product family, prepared for the incoming director. Margin compressed 2.4 points year on year, driven mainly by freight costs on the Ostwick lane and discounting in the Marbrook region. Mitigations under evaluation include supplier renegotiation and a revised discount ladder. Please treat all figures as provisional pending audit. The forward plan depends on decisions recorded in the confidential note below.

management briefing: Jorixax Holdings is in early talks to buy Casixax Holdings for about $420.3 million. The Fenmir launch date is October 27, and nothing goes to the press before then. Legal wants the Keloxek Foods term sheet redrafted before April 16.

Handing off the Shrinkwrap CLI before sprint close. Batch resize works fine up to ~5k images, but memory balloons past that — probably the thumbnail cache never evicting. WebP output flag is half-done on the feature branch. Tests pass locally, CI config still needs the new image fixtures. Questions after Thursday should go to the owner listed below.

account owner for fajep-yagef: Kasix Eliiel

## Runbook: ScanBridge Intake Failures

If the Vexler warehouse scanners stop registering, first confirm the ScanBridge daemon is running on the intake host. Restart it only after draining the pending queue, or duplicate SKUs will post to Ledgerline. Verify the handshake port matches what the scanners broadcast. The current production settings are listed below for reference.

service settings:
druael:
  pin: 7528
  metrics_host: metrics.druael.lumiclabs.internal
  tenant: wendor
  seal: seal_c765840a